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a trained technician to ass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property. Our team will identify the source of the water damage and develop a customized plan to dry and restore your property. We’ll also provide you with a detailed estimate of the work to be done.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property. This includes powerful pumps and wet vacuums that can handle even the largest amounts of water.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use advanced equipment to dry and dehumidify your property, including air movers and dehumidifiers. This helps to prevent further damage and spe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

We’ll clean and disinfect all surfaces and materials affected by the water damage, including carpets, upholstery, and drywall. This helps to prevent mold and mildew growth and ensures your property is safe and healthy.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Finally, we’ll restore and reconstruct any damaged areas of your property, including walls, ceilings, and floors. We’ll work with you to select materials and finishes that match your original property, ensuring a seamless transition back to normal.

Residential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
You’re dealing with a small leak or spill. Yes No You can likely handle it yourself with some basic cleaning and drying.
You’ve got a large area of standing water (over 2 inches). No Yes It’s too much for you to handle safely and effectively on your own.
You’re not sure where the water is coming from. No Yes You need a professional to identify and fix the source of the leak.
You’ve got mold or mildew growth. No Yes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and techniques to safely remove and prevent future growth.
You’re dealing with a flooded basement or crawlspace. No Yes It’s too much for you to handle safely and effectively on your own, and can lead to structural damage if not addressed properly.
You’re unsure what to do or how to proceed. No Yes It’s always best to err on the side of caution and call a professional to ensure your property is restored correctly and safely.

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ost In Marblehead, MA

The c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ration in Marblehead, MA can vary widely dep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as the size of the affected area. Our estimates are always free and based on an on-site assessment. Here are some general price ranges to exp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water extracted
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, complexity of drying process
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, complexity of restoration process
Complete Service Package $3,000 – $15,000 Size of affected area, complexity of restoration process
